Makinde Presents N310b 2023 Budget Proposal to State Assembly

Governor Seyi Makinde of Oyo State has on Thursday presented a budget of N310 billion budget proposal to the State House of Assembly for the 2023 fiscal year.

The budget is tagged: “Budget of Sustainable Development.

While presenting the appropriation, Makinde noted that his administration in the last three and half years has moved the state forward from poverty to prosperity which led to accelerated development for the state.

The state projected N83billion as Internally Generated Revenue (IGR) for 2023 while capital expenditure stands at 154,348,866,965.

It earmarked N155billion for recurrent expenditure while 85 billion is budgeted for infrastructural development.

The Education sector received N58.2 billion representing 18.8% of the total budget while Agriculture got N11.1 billion representing 6.31 percent of the total budget, and N36billion earmarked for Health.

Governor Makinde said the figure represents an increase of a hundred percent from the 2022 budget due to a concessionary loan from the French government on a moratorium of ten years.

The French government has also assured that the concessionary may be converted to a grant if certain conditions are met, he added.
